In recent years a lot of importance has been placed on energy efficiency, which is no surprise given that it results in cheaper utility bills, reduced maintenance requirements and less use of non-renewable energy sources.
Due to these facts, the supply and demand of LED lighting has advanced remarkably.
Though LED lighting is initially slightly more expensive than a standard incandescent light, the cost is earned back over time.
LED lighting can last up to 25 times longer than a typical incandescent which in turn lowers the overall energy costs during the bulbs life.
Depending on how they are used, an LED can approach an operational life of up to 100’000 hours (over 11 years) and requires less maintenance and replacing over time; showing why LED lighting is quickly becoming the mainstream lighting technology used today.
The use of LED lighting has become widespread within the automotive industry, commercial offices, manufacturing industry and households amongst many more.
LED bulbs are bright, light up immediately and can be dimmable.
LED bulbs are suitable for both indoor and outdoor use due to being rust proof, and the thick epoxy used to create them makes them highly durable and difficult to break.
